2020-06-18 19:53发布
1、接口文档没有提及的一个查询的接口
文档没有提及根据手机号查询交易流水
2、WEB根据手机号查询交易流水
3.写postman的接口测试
(1)路径url:postman的url和前端的url是一样的
(2)发送请求:post
(3)请求头:a.Content-Type互联网媒体类型:application/json键-值”对的方式组织的数据
b.认证信息:Authorization 登录的时候获取http://**web.yidianche.net/pressure/132****(这个是专门用来获取 Authorization 认证信息的) 区别:http://***web.yidianche.net/performance132***(这个是前端直接登录,不 需要扫描)
(4)请求体body:raw方式,写成字符串的形式WEB和postman的数据也是一样的
如果你说的这些都成立,也没有太好的工具来帮你自动化,那么你面对的就是一个黑盒,而黑盒测试你能做的工作其实非常有限,又或者你可以写个脚本先把所有的api地址给生成出来,然后用爬虫脚本去爬一边所有的接口数据,再人肉。
如果你们能在百忙中抽出一点时间,部署一个code doc的方案,那么每一个修改都带上注释,会逐步帮你们建立起接口文档。等覆盖率差不多的时候建立git pre-commit之前必须有注释的机制,来补全所有的内容。
不过这一切终究是要靠人来完成,工具只能减轻工作量,如果大家都很忙,我觉得最好的办法就是不要再考虑接口测试的问题。
最多设置5个标签!
1、接口文档没有提及的一个查询的接口
文档没有提及根据手机号查询交易流水
2、WEB根据手机号查询交易流水
3.写postman的接口测试
(1)路径url:postman的url和前端的url是一样的
(2)发送请求:post
(3)请求头:a.Content-Type互联网媒体类型:application/json键-值”对的方式组织的数据
b.认证信息:Authorization 登录的时候获取http://**web.yidianche.net/pressure/132****(这个是专门用来获取 Authorization 认证信息的) 区别:http://***web.yidianche.net/performance132***(这个是前端直接登录,不 需要扫描)
(4)请求体body:raw方式,写成字符串的形式WEB和postman的数据也是一样的
回答: 2021-10-29 16:16
如果你说的这些都成立,也没有太好的工具来帮你自动化,那么你面对的就是一个黑盒,而黑盒测试你能做的工作其实非常有限,又或者你可以写个脚本先把所有的api地址给生成出来,然后用爬虫脚本去爬一边所有的接口数据,再人肉。
如果你们能在百忙中抽出一点时间,部署一个code doc的方案,那么每一个修改都带上注释,会逐步帮你们建立起接口文档。等覆盖率差不多的时候建立git pre-commit之前必须有注释的机制,来补全所有的内容。
不过这一切终究是要靠人来完成,工具只能减轻工作量,如果大家都很忙,我觉得最好的办法就是不要再考虑接口测试的问题。
一周热门 更多>